Legal SEO Agency Review for Law Firms

A legal seo agency review should not start with a slick proposal or a polished sales deck. It should start with one question: will this agency help your firm generate qualified cases, or will it waste 6 to 12 months while competitors take the search results you should own?

That is the standard law firms need to use. Not whether the agency talks a good game. Not whether it sends pretty reports. Not whether it uses the latest buzzwords. If you are paying for legal marketing, the work should produce visibility in Google Search, stronger placement in Google Maps, better performance in AI-driven search experiences, and more consultations from people ready to hire a lawyer.

What a legal SEO agency review should actually measure

Most law firms review agencies the wrong way. They compare price, glance at a few rankings, and assume every company offering legal SEO is selling roughly the same service. That is a costly mistake.

A real review has to measure specialization, execution, accountability, and business impact. Legal search is not the same as SEO for home services, ecommerce, or software companies. Practice area competition is intense. Local intent matters. Content quality matters. Review signals matter. Website speed and conversion paths matter. In high-value legal markets, a weak strategy does not just slow growth. It hands market share to another firm.

The first thing to review is whether the agency truly focuses on law firms. If legal marketing is just one category among dentists, roofers, med spas, and plumbers, that agency is not specialized enough for a serious law practice. Attorneys need a team that understands practice area pages, city pages, local pack competition, intake friction, reputation risk, and the compliance realities that come with legal advertising.

The second thing is whether the agency has a ranking strategy that matches how search works right now. That no longer means Google alone. Search behavior is shifting into AI Overviews, ChatGPT-assisted discovery, map-driven local research, and branded reputation checks before a prospect ever fills out a form. If an agency still acts like legal SEO begins and ends with title tags and blog posts, it is behind.

Legal SEO agency review criteria that matter most

A strong legal SEO agency review should examine how the agency handles four connected areas: organic search, local maps, authority signals, and conversion.

Organic search is still the foundation. Your agency should be able to explain how it will build out practice area relevance, location relevance, internal content structure, technical performance, and topical authority. Vague promises about getting you to page one are not enough. The agency should show how it plans to win specific searches that bring in actual matters, not vanity traffic.

Local maps can be even more valuable for firms targeting county, city, or metro-level cases. This means your Google Business Profile, reviews, map citations, location signals, and local landing pages need active management. Many agencies underdeliver here because map SEO requires consistency and constant attention. For a law firm, that gap can mean losing calls from prospects who never scroll past the local pack.

Authority signals are where many generic agencies fall apart. A law firm’s online visibility depends on more than website content. Legal directories, review platforms, business listings, brand mentions, and overall trust signals all influence how search engines and AI systems evaluate your firm. If the agency does not have a plan for directory optimization, review acquisition, reputation management, and brand consistency, the strategy is incomplete.

Then there is conversion. Rankings matter only if visitors become leads. A legal website should load fast, look credible, guide users clearly, and make it easy to call, submit a form, or take the next step. Agencies that obsess over traffic while ignoring intake conversion are selling half a service.

The biggest red flags in any legal seo agency review

The fastest way to spot a weak agency is to listen for what it avoids.

If the agency cannot show legal-specific examples, that is a red flag. If it talks mostly about impressions instead of signed cases, that is a red flag. If it promises instant rankings in a highly competitive market, that is a red flag. Good agencies move aggressively, but they also understand that legal SEO is competitive and market-dependent.

Another red flag is generic reporting. Law firms do not need a monthly email filled with jargon and screenshots. They need clear performance indicators tied to growth: keyword movement for high-intent searches, map visibility, call volume, form volume, lead quality, and website engagement that supports conversion.

You should also be cautious when an agency treats AI as a side note. AI optimization is now part of search visibility. Prospects are increasingly using AI tools to compare firms, ask legal questions, and validate options before contacting anyone. Agencies that are not adapting content, brand signals, and entity authority for AI-driven discovery are leaving opportunity on the table.

Finally, be careful with agencies that avoid accountability. Month-to-month flexibility can sound attractive, but so can long contracts that trap underperforming clients. What matters is not the contract structure alone. It is whether the agency takes ownership of results, defines benchmarks, and communicates a clear path to measurable improvement.

Why AI matters in a modern legal SEO agency review

This is where many law firms are behind the curve.

A serious legal seo agency review now needs to ask how the agency approaches AI optimization. Not as a gimmick. As a visibility channel. Google is changing how answers are presented. Searchers are using conversational tools to find attorneys, compare options, and understand legal issues before they ever click a traditional result.

That changes what strong legal marketing looks like. Your website content needs to be structured clearly enough for AI systems to interpret it. Your brand needs consistent signals across legal directories, business citations, reviews, and web mentions. Your firm needs pages that establish practice area depth, geographic relevance, and trust. The firms that build this foundation now will be easier to surface in both search and AI-generated recommendations.

For law firms competing in crowded markets, that advantage matters. A traditional SEO campaign can still improve rankings. But a modern legal marketing campaign should also position the firm for where search behavior is going next. That is one reason agencies focused on AI optimization, legal authority signals, and local visibility are separating themselves from old-school SEO vendors.

How law firms should compare agencies without getting sold

Start by asking the agency what it would prioritize in the first 90 days. The answer should sound specific. If your website is slow, your local profiles are weak, your reviews are thin, and your practice pages are underbuilt, the agency should say so. Strong firms do not hide behind generalities.

Ask what parts of the work are handled in-house. Ask how content is developed for legal topics. Ask how they approach Google Business Profile optimization, review strategy, legal directory placement, and conversion improvements. Ask what role AI optimization plays in the campaign. If the answers are shallow, the service probably is too.

Then ask how success will be measured. This is where serious agencies separate themselves. They should talk about first-page visibility, local map presence, qualified traffic, lead generation, and conversion improvement. They should not need to be pushed toward ROI. For law firms, ROI is the point.

If the agency offers a guarantee, review the fine print. Not all guarantees are equal. Some are built around low-value keywords that do not drive cases. Others are meaningful because they align with commercial search terms that matter to the firm’s practice areas. A guarantee can reduce risk, but only if it is tied to outcomes that move the business.

A specialized legal marketing partner should feel like an extension of your growth team, not a vendor you have to chase. That means strategic direction, execution, responsiveness, and a clear understanding of how attorneys compete online.

The bottom line on any legal SEO agency review

The right agency will not sell you generic SEO packaged for lawyers. It will build a legal visibility system designed to rank, convert, and strengthen your authority across search, maps, reviews, directories, and AI-driven discovery.

For firms that are serious about growth, that distinction is everything. A mediocre agency can keep you busy. A specialized one can help you take market share. If you are reviewing your options, look past the pitch and look at the operating model. The firms winning online are not buying marketing activity. They are investing in measurable visibility that turns into retained clients.

If your current agency cannot explain how it will get your firm found in search, trusted on review platforms, visible in maps, and understood by AI systems, it is time to ask harder questions.
